UNPACKING
This product requires assembly.
  Carefully remove the tool and any accessories from the 
box. Make sure that all items listed in the packing list are 
included.
  Inspect the tool carefully to make sure no breakage or 
damage occurred during shipping.
  Do not discard the packing material until you have care-
fully inspected and satisfactorily operated the tool.
  If  any  parts  are  damaged  or  missing,  please  call 
1-800-525-2579 for assistance.

INSTALLING THE SIDE HANDLE
See Figure 2.
� 
Unplug the angle grinder.
  Insert  the  side  handle  into  the  desired  operating  
position.
 
Securely tighten by turning the side handle clockwise.
NOTE: You can install the handle on the left or right side of 
the grinder depending on operator preference.

WARNING: 
Thoroughly  inspect  a  new  grinding  wheel  before  you 
install it on the grinder.
• Tap lightly around the wheel using a wooden hammer.
• Listen carefully to the resulting sounds. Places with fis-
sures or cracks will result in a different sound.
Do not use a wheel containing fissures or cracks.
When you install a new grinding wheel, carry out a no 
load  revolution  test  of  approximately  one  minute  with 
the grinding wheel facing a safe direction, i.e., away from 
people or objects.
WARNING:
The side handle must always be used to help prevent 
loss of control and possible serious injury.
